Discover the Best Free Walking Tours in Major UK Cities

London

London, the bustling capital of the United Kingdom, offers a plethora of free walking tours that cater to different interests. Whether you want to explore the iconic landmarks of the city or delve into its rich history, there’s a tour for everyone. The Royal London Free Walking Tour takes you through the heart of the city, showcasing famous sites like Buckingham Palace, Big Ben, and the Tower of London. Alternatively, you can join themed tours that focus on subjects like street art, Harry Potter, or even the notorious Jack the Ripper.

Edinburgh

Edinburgh, with its enchanting medieval streets and stunning architecture, is another city that boasts excellent free walking tours. The Royal Mile, a historic street that connects the Edinburgh Castle to the Palace of Holyroodhouse, is a popular starting point for many tours. You can explore the city’s dark history on the Ghosts and Gore Tour or learn about its literary heritage on the Harry Potter-themed tour. For those interested in the city’s spooky side, the Edinburgh Haunted History Tour is a must-visit.

Manchester

Manchester, a vibrant city in northern England, also offers free walking tours that showcase its industrial past and cultural present. The Manchester Free Walking Tours take you on a journey through the city, covering its iconic landmarks such as the Town Hall and John Rylands Library. Additionally, you can delve into the city’s rich musical heritage on the Manchester Music Tour or explore the vibrant street art scene on the Northern Quarter Street Art Tour.

Birmingham

Birmingham, known for its iconic canals and industrial heritage, is another major UK city where you can enjoy free walking tours. The Birmingham Free Walking Tours cover the city’s diverse history, from its role in the Industrial Revolution to its vibrant cultural scene. You can explore the Jewellery Quarter, known for its traditional craftsmanship, or discover the hidden gems of Digbeth, a hip and creative district. The tours also provide insights into the city’s architecture and the famous Cadbury chocolate factory.

Glasgow

Glasgow, a city renowned for its Victorian and art nouveau architecture, also offers free walking tours that allow visitors to discover its rich history and artistic heritage. The Glasgow Walking Tours cover various themes such as the city’s music scene, street art, and its role in the Scottish Enlightenment. The Merchant City tour is especially popular, as it takes you through the historic heart of the city, showcasing its stunning buildings and vibrant atmosphere.

Oxford

Oxford, famous for its prestigious university and stunning architecture, is a city that shouldn’t be missed on your UK itinerary. While most guided tours in Oxford require a fee, there are some free walking tours available. These tours provide insights into the city’s history, traditions, and notable alumni. You can explore the famous colleges, visit the Bodleian Library, and discover the city’s hidden courtyards and gardens.
